Maija Haavisto is a notable author known for her unique storytelling and engaging narratives. Her works often blend elements of science fiction and the human experience, exploring themes that resonate with a wide audience. With titles such as "The Self-Inflicted Relative: 33 Fantastic Stories in 100 Words" and "A Practical Guide to the Resurrected: Twenty-One Short Stories of Science Fiction and Medicine," she demonstrates a keen ability to weave complex ideas into accessible prose. Her writing has garnered attention for its imaginative scope and insightful commentary on contemporary issues.

In addition to her fiction, Haavisto's stories often reflect her interest in the intersection of science and art. This thematic focus allows her to push the boundaries of traditional genres, inviting readers to think critically about the implications of technological advancements on society and individual lives.
